JORDAN LAUNCH ARAB CUP CAMPAIGN WITH VICTORY
Dec 03, 2025
Jordan have launched their Arab Cup campaign with a hard earned 2-1 victory over the United Arab Emirates on Wednesday in Doha, Qatar.
Ali Al-Alwan scored Jordan’s opening goal in the 20th minute from the penalty spot, after Yazan Al-Naimat was brought down.
Al-Naimat won another penalty in the 39th minute, but Al-Alwan was unable to convert his second spot kick.
The UAE equalised in the 47th minute, early in the second half, before Al-Naimat - the standout performer of the match - scored the decisive goal for Jordan in the 63rd minute.
With this result, Jordan tops Group C with three points, ahead of Egypt and Kuwait, whose match ended in a 1–1 draw.
Jordan will play its second group-stage match on Saturday at 2pm against Kuwait at Ahmed bin Ali Stadium.
